技术文摘
Perl语言概述术语汇编
Perl语言概述术语汇编
Perl是一种功能强大且灵活的编程语言,在文本处理、系统管理和网络编程等领域有着广泛应用。了解一些关键的Perl术语,有助于更好地掌握这门语言。
变量
在Perl中,变量是存储数据的基本单元。有三种主要的变量类型:标量变量(Scalar),以美元符号($)开头,用于存储单个值,如数字或字符串;数组变量(Array),以@符号开头,可存储多个值的有序列表;哈希变量(Hash),以%符号开头,用于存储键值对。
正则表达式
正则表达式是Perl的一大特色。它提供了一种强大的模式匹配和文本搜索替换机制。通过特定的模式语法,可以轻松地在文本中查找、匹配和替换符合特定规则的字符串。例如,使用正则表达式可以验证电子邮件地址的格式是否正确。
函数和子程序
Perl中的函数和子程序是可重复使用的代码块。函数通常返回一个值,而子程序可以执行一系列操作。通过定义和调用函数及子程序,可以提高代码的模块化和可维护性。
文件操作
Perl提供了丰富的文件操作功能。可以打开、读取、写入和关闭文件。使用文件句柄来引用打开的文件,通过相关的函数进行文件内容的处理。这使得Perl在处理日志文件、配置文件等方面非常方便。
模块
模块是Perl中代码复用的重要方式。模块是一组相关的函数、变量和子程序的集合,通过使用模块,可以将复杂的功能封装起来,方便在不同的程序中使用。常见的模块如CPAN(Comprehensive Perl Archive Network)上的各种模块,提供了各种功能,如数据库连接、网络通信等。
循环和条件语句
Perl支持多种循环结构,如for、while和foreach循环,用于重复执行一段代码。条件语句如if-else和unless,用于根据条件执行不同的代码块。
Perl语言具有丰富的术语和功能。掌握这些关键术语,能够更好地理解和编写高效的Perl程序,发挥其在不同领域的优势。
- InstallShield 中基于主机名获取 IP 地址的代码
- InstallShield 中 WINSOCK 引用的示例代码
- Erlang 分布式节点中注册进程的使用实例
- Erlang 中映射组 Map 的详细解析
- Go 语言实现类似 Python 中 with 上下文管理器的详解
- CGI 脚本入门学习资源
- Erlang 中注册进程的使用实例
- Golang 语法运用的注意要点
- 《Erlang 程序设计(第 2 版)》读书笔记:Erlang 安装与基础语法
- JScript/VBScript 调试方法
- Rational 对象的脚本命令
- Erlang 项目内存泄漏的分析之道
- 深入探究 Go 语言中 database/sql 的设计原理
- CentOS 6.5 下 Erlang 源码安装教程
- 关于 Cygwin 的使用体会